More about work skill instructor courses in Western Australia
The demand for qualified Work Skill Instructors in Western Australia has been steadily increasing, making it an ideal time to pursue Work Skill Instructor courses in Western Australia. These courses are designed to equip learners with the necessary skills and knowledge to effectively teach and guide individuals or groups in various work settings. With only one available course in the region, prospective students have the opportunity to gain a solid foundation in this rewarding career path.
One of the most popular offering is the Work Skill Instructor Skill Set TAESS00028, which caters to beginners with no prior experience or qualifications. This course is ideal for those looking to enter the field, providing a comprehensive introduction to the key principles and teaching methods used in vocational education and training. With its beginner-friendly approach, this skill set paves the way for a fulfilling career as a Work Skill Instructor.
In Western Australia, courses are facilitated by trusted training providers such as Trainwest. These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) provide high-quality training and are recognised within the industry, ensuring that learners receive valuable education and support throughout their studies. By participating in Work Skill Instructor courses in Western Australia, students are more likely to succeed in their career goals thanks to the expertise and resources offered by these training providers.
Once equipped with the necessary qualifications, graduates of the Work Skill Instructor courses can explore various job roles including Work Skill Instructor, Vocational Education Teacher, and Training Coordinator. These roles are integral in shaping the workforce of tomorrow, and trained professionals are sought after across a range of industries. The skills learned during training are not only applicable in educational settings but can also extend to corporate training and development, providing students with diverse employment opportunities.
